Output e73285c69973f505a457328b91d610328cce1152ecd6110d1e43c7752553aa1c:0

value
60137
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b181a8d0c555ce05bb62fb085924cc6e9c75ac53 OP_EQUAL
address
3HsarPmBHz3nRCHkeSZJzxnMKiputQL1YH
transaction
e73285c69973f505a457328b91d610328cce1152ecd6110d1e43c7752553aa1c
confirmations
146126
spent
true